Description: Assessment Laws and Procedures is an introd
uctory 28-hour course dealing with the assessment field in Minnesota. Part
icipants will learn about property tax laws in Minnesota, real estate law a
nd assessment procedures. It includes 3-hour Ethics that satisfies licensi
ng requirements. This course is designed for individuals who are just begi
nning their study of the assessment field, but also can serve as a review f
or persons currently working in assessment. This is a required course for
the Certified Minnesota Assessor level of licensure. This course is approv
ed by the Minnesota State Board of Assessor’s for 28 hours of continuing ed
ucation, 30 hours with exam.
